Vanessa Lima is a scholar working on Molecular Biology, Nutrition and Dietetics and Physiology. According to data from OpenAlex, Vanessa Lima has authored 23 papers receiving a total of 411 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Molecular Biology, 8 papers in Nutrition and Dietetics and 6 papers in Physiology. Recurrent topics in Vanessa Lima's work include Receptor Mechanisms and Signaling (7 papers), Nitric Oxide and Endothelin Effects (4 papers) and Adipokines, Inflammation, and Metabolic Diseases (4 papers). Vanessa Lima is often cited by papers focused on Receptor Mechanisms and Signaling (7 papers), Nitric Oxide and Endothelin Effects (4 papers) and Adipokines, Inflammation, and Metabolic Diseases (4 papers). Vanessa Lima collaborates with scholars based in Brazil, United States and Mexico. Vanessa Lima's co-authors include Ana Heloneida de Araújo Morais, Bruna Leal Lima Maciel, André Sampaio Pupo, Grasiela Piuvezam, Elizeu Antunes dos Santos, Lucas T. Parreiras‐e‐Silva, Diego A. Duarte, Cláudio M. Costa-Neto, Adriana Ferreira Uchôa and Luiz Ricardo de Almeida Kiguti and has published in prestigious journals such as SHILAP Revista de lepidopterología, PLoS ONE and The FASEB Journal.
